Conor McGregor opens the scrapped UFC 303 press conference that was scheduled for Monday … and while he didn’t explain exactly why it was canceled, he did say it was due to a number of issues.
Notorious and Michael Chandler were going to spout some nonsense in Dublin to promote the June 29 event… but just hours before everything was due to take place, the organizers confirmed that this was not allowed until further notice – without providing any further information.
Now Conor is shedding some light on the situation… saying, “In consultation with the UFC, today’s press conference was canceled due to a series of obstacles beyond our control.”
Conor expressed his regret over all of this… adding: “I apologize to my Irish fans and fans around the world for the inconvenience and appreciate all your passion and support.”

A sellout crowd was expected to head to Ireland’s 3Arena for the big in-person press conference… but their schedules for today are now pretty clear.
There’s no update on the status of the actual fight between McGregor and Chandler… so it sounds like it’s still happening – but the fact that Conor didn’t include a date in his statement may raise some eyebrows.
